Formaldehyde emission and properties of comprenated wood treated with low molecular weight phenol formaldehyde with addition of urea
Phenol formaldehyde (PF) resin impregnation and compression at considerable high hot pressing pressure of jelutong and sesenduk is attractive for the improvement of strength properties,dimensional stability and decay durability.
